yaSSL, or yet another SSL, is an embedded ssl library for programmers building security functionality into their applications and devices. yaSSL is highly portable, and runs on standard as well as embedded platforms(QNX, ThreadX, VxWorks, Tron)

yaSSL is still available but no longer being developed. Current development on the same project continues under wolfSSL. Visit yaSSL Home above for the latest stable release.

Features

  • TLS version 1.2
  • DTLS
  • Less than 50k memory
  • OpenSSL compatibility layer
  • Mongoose Web Server Support
  • AES-NI support
  • Lighttpd (lighty) support
  • multi-platform
